  5. Nonlinear rheology of micelles and polymers

    This thesis is concerned with the theory of polymer rheology. 'Living polymers' are chain-like structures which closely resemble ordinary polymers, except that they can break and reform reversibly. The best-studied examples are wormlike surfactant micelles. A model for these systems has recently …
